What type of modifications are coming that could be video game changers in the cryptocurrency industry?

One of the greatest modifications that will certainly influence the cryptocurrency world is an alternative technique of block validation called Evidence of Stake (PoS). We will certainly try to maintain this explanation rather high level, yet it is essential to have a theoretical understanding of what the difference is as well as why it is a substantial variable.

Keep in mind that the underlying modern technology with electronic money is called blockchain and also most of the present electronic currencies make use of a validation protocol called Evidence of Work (PoW).

With traditional approaches of repayment, you need to rely on a third party, such as Visa, Interact, or a financial institution, or a cheque clearing up house to resolve your transaction. These trusted entities are ” systematized”, implying they maintain their very own personal journal which saves the deal’s background and balance of each account. They will reveal the transactions to you, as well as you need to agree that it is right, or release a conflict. Just the events to the transaction ever see it.

With Bitcoin as well as most other electronic money, the journals are “decentralized”, indicating every person on the network obtains a duplicate, so no one has to rely on a third party, such as a financial institution, because any individual can straight verify the information. This confirmation procedure is called “distributed consensus.”

PoW calls for that ” job” be carried out in order to validate a new deal for access on the blockchain. With cryptocurrencies, that recognition is done by “miners”, who have to address intricate mathematical problems. As the algorithmic troubles come to be a lot more intricate, these “miners” require extra costly and also more effective computers to address the troubles ahead of every person else. “Mining” computer systems are usually specialized, typically making use of ASIC chips (Application Particular Integrated Circuits), which are much more skilled as well as faster at resolving these challenging problems.

Below is the process:

Purchases are bundled with each other in a ‘block’.
The miners validate that the purchases within each block are reputable by resolving the hashing algorithm puzzle, known as the “proof of work problem”.
The initial miner to resolve the block’s ” evidence of job issue” is awarded with a percentage of cryptocurrency.
When verified, the deals are kept in the general public blockchain throughout the entire network.
As the variety of transactions and also miners boost, the difficulty of solving the hashing troubles likewise increases.
Although PoW aided get blockchain and also decentralized, trustless electronic currencies off the ground, it has some genuine drawbacks, specifically with the quantity of electrical power these miners are taking in trying to resolve the “proof of work issues” as quick as feasible. According to Digiconomist’s Bitcoin Power Intake Index, Bitcoin miners are utilizing extra energy than 159 countries, including Ireland. As the cost of each Bitcoin climbs, a growing number of miners try to solve the problems, taking in much more energy.
Every one of that power usage just to confirm the deals has actually inspired many in the digital currency area to seek out alternate technique of verifying the blocks, as well as the top prospect is a technique called ” Evidence of Risk” (PoS).

PoS is still an algorithm, as well as the objective is the same as in the evidence of job, yet the process to get to the goal is rather various. With PoS, there are no miners, however instead we have “validators.” PoS counts on depend on and also the expertise that all the people who are confirming deals have skin in the game.

In this manner, instead of using power to address PoW puzzles, a PoS validator is limited to validating a portion of purchases that is reflective of his/her ownership stake. As an example, a validator that possesses 3% of the Ether offered can theoretically confirm only 3% of the blocks.

In PoW, the possibilities of you resolving the proof of work trouble depends on how much computing power you have. With PoS, it depends on just how much cryptocurrency you have at ” risk”. The greater the stake you have, the higher the chances that you fix the block. As opposed to winning crypto coins, the winning validator obtains purchase charges.

Validators enter their stake by ‘ securing’ a portion of their fund tokens. Must they try to do something harmful versus the network, like developing an ‘ void block’, their risk or down payment will certainly be surrendered. If they do their job as well as do not violate the network, yet do not win the right to verify the block, they will certainly get their risk or deposit back.

If you recognize the standard distinction in between PoW and PoS, that is all you need to understand. Just those that prepare to be miners or validators require to understand all the ins and outs of these 2 recognition methods. The majority of the public that want to have cryptocurrencies will merely purchase them via an exchange, as well as not join the actual mining or verifying of block purchases.

Many in the crypto market believe that in order for digital money to make it through long-lasting, electronic tokens need to switch over to a PoS version. At the time of composing this message, Ethereum is the 2nd largest electronic money behind Bitcoin as well as their growth team has been servicing their PoS formula called “Casper” over the last few years. It is anticipated that we will certainly see Casper applied in 2018, putting Ethereum ahead of all the various other huge cryptocurrencies.
